Ricciardo and Verstappen 'won't fall out' over F1 title

Red Bull team mates Daniel Ricciardo and Max Verstappen have pledged to stay friends, even if they end up being title rivals in 2018. "I hope so," said Ricciardo when asked whether their friendship could survive a sustained championship battle. "Keep him on my birthday list! "We said at the start of 2017 it would be a good problem to have," he continued. "If we're both fighting at the front and having some battles. "If it's ultimately deciding a world title we would happily run with that challenge," the Australian added. "So, yeah, we'll see."
